Doha: Nawaf bin Mohammed Al Maawda, Minister of Justice, Islamic Affairs and Endowments, participated in the Doha Legal Forum, held in the State of Qatar under the theme "Emerging Trends and Forward-Looking Insights". The forum was inaugurated by His Excellency Sheikh Mohammed bin Abdulrahman bin Jassim Al Thani, Prime Minister and Minister of Foreign Affairs of the State of Qatar.
According to Bahrain News Agency, on the sidelines of the forum, Minister Al Maawda highlighted the value of international legal gatherings in fostering cooperation, sharing expertise, and exchanging best practices in legal and judicial domains. He emphasized their contribution to legislative development, strengthening the rule of law, and building adaptable legal frameworks capable of responding to rapid economic and technological change.
The forum focuses on legal and regulatory issues related to investment, emerging technologies, governance, and investment dispute resolution, with the aim of enhancing confidence in the business environment and supporting sustainable development and economic diversification.
It also provides an international platform for dialogue on the future of legislation and the judiciary, showcasing legal frameworks governing key economic sectors and their role in creating a secure, stable, and attractive investment climate through constructive engagement among participants.
